2017 British Open (real tennis)

The men's event was held at the Queen's Club in London between November 12–21, 2017 and was organised by the Tennis and Rackets Association.

It was the final event in the qualifying series for the 2018 Real Tennis World Championship.

[1][2] The women's event was held at the Seacourt Tennis Club on Hayling Island between April 5–9, 2017.

The men's singles draw was won by Camden Riviere, his third British Open title.

In the women's draw, Claire Fahey won her fifth British Open singles title, forming part of her fifth calendar year Grand Slam.
